Output 98b5fa6b4d4975de1c6b8e50b79f2646701f2a0e2e83db3bbf8902f8b63bfba8:0

value
2530688000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e68192321dc9e0b51309571db3f10dc0be0aff0 OP_EQUALVERIFY OP_CHECKSIG
address
D6TGhp86B3wTNEsknr6EByhmAuU9LToT1B
transaction
98b5fa6b4d4975de1c6b8e50b79f2646701f2a0e2e83db3bbf8902f8b63bfba8